Armenia is currently undergoing a massive energy transformation. With over 2,500 hours of sunshine per year, the solar potential in Armenia significantly exceeds the European average. As a premier On-Grid Solar System Supplier & Exporter, we understand that the Armenian market requires more than just hardware; it requires localized expertise and high-durability components capable of withstanding the micro-climates of the Caucasus.
The Armenian government’s commitment to increasing the share of renewables to 15% by 2030 has opened significant doors for Commercial and Industrial (C&I) enterprises. Our systems are designed to integrate seamlessly with the Electric Networks of Armenia (ENA), facilitating hassle-free net-metering and excess power feedback.

Yes, Armenia's net-metering laws allow residential and commercial users to feed excess energy back into the ENA (Electric Networks of Armenia) grid, receiving credits that can be used during nighttime or winter months.
Our modules feature a reinforced frame design capable of handling 5400Pa snow loads. Additionally, our N-Type cells have better low-light performance, ensuring energy generation even during overcast winter days.
Given the rising electricity tariffs and high solar radiation, most C&I projects in Armenia see a Return on Investment (ROI) within 4 to 6 years, with a system lifespan exceeding 25 years.
